A108291 Triangle, read by rows, resulting from the matrix product of triangle A108267 with Pascal's triangle (A007318).

Original entry on oeis.org

1, 2, 1, 9, 9, 1, 64, 96, 34, 1, 625, 1250, 750, 125, 1, 7776, 19440, 16470, 5265, 461, 1, 117649, 352947, 386561, 184877, 35329, 1715, 1, 2097152, 7340032, 9863168, 6307840, 1913408, 232288, 6434, 1, 43046721, 172186884, 274223556, 220016574
Offset: 0

Comments

Row sums form A108292. Column 0 is A000169(n) = (n+1)^n. Triangle with rows reversed is A108290.

Examples

			Triangle begins:
1;
2,1;
9,9,1;
64,96,34,1;
625,1250,750,125,1;
7776,19440,16470,5265,461,1;
117649,352947,386561,184877,35329,1715,1;
2097152,7340032,9863168,6307840,1913408,232288,6434,1; ...
